  • Hear the various clean tones of the Pacifica 112V - ranging from full and warm to sparkling and funky.
    The Yamaha PAC112V combines renowned Yamaha build quality and playability with superb tone and a choice of finishes. An alder body, bolt-on maple neck with rosewood fretboard, Alnico V pickups, and a vintage-style tremolo bridge complement this versatile instrument. The PAC112VM with a maple fretboard is also available.
    • Multiple finishes including new Vintage White and United Blue
    • Alder body with gloss polyurethane finish
    • Bolt-on maple neck with rosewood (PAC112V) or maple (PAC112VM) fretboard
    • Alnico V pickups deliver warm, clear tone
    • S/S/H pickup configuration with 5-position selector
    • Push-pull coil-split switch for additional tonal options
    • Vintage-style tremolo bridge with block saddles
